Crouch Wonder Goal Stands Tall Over Rivals

Despite hitting a fantastic goal against Chelsea, Papiss Cisse is not at the top of the betting for this year’s Match of the Day Goal of the Season. Peter Crouch’s effort for Stoke vs Manchester City is 10/11 then followed by Cisse’s second effort at Stamford Bridge at 6/5. Luis Suarez’s effort from the halfway line against Norwich is the 6/1 third favourite followed by any other goal at 16/1.

“It looks like it will be a two horse race for the Goal of the Season honour and we think it could still go either way,” said Hill’s spokesman Joe Crilly.

William Hill BBC Match Of The Day Goal of the Season: 10/11 Peter Crouch; 6/5 Papiss Cisse; 6/1 Luis Suarez; 16/1 Any other
